Riverside Park is a popular destination for outdoor activities and family events. Customers appreciate the large playgrounds, splashpad, tennis courts, baseball diamonds, skatepark, mountain bike tracks, hiking trails, soccer fields, and picnic areas. The park is known for its natural beauty, with tranquil lakes, lush greenery, and vibrant flowers. The serene atmosphere makes it an ideal place for a peaceful morning walk or a family outing. Parking can be a challenge at times, but there are usually plenty of options nearby. Dogs are allowed on a leash, and some areas encourage a shorter leash for the playgrounds. Restrooms are hit or miss, and availability may depend on cleaning schedules. Overall, Riverside Park is highly recommended for its abundance of activities and natural beauty.
